如何使用AI语音SDK实现语音指令的智能推荐功能

随着人工智能技术的不断发展,AI语音SDK在各个领域的应用越来越广泛。在智能家居、智能客服、智能教育等行业,语音指令的智能推荐功能已经成为提升用户体验的关键。本文将讲述一位开发者如何使用AI语音SDK实现语音指令的智能推荐功能,并分享他的心路历程。

一、初识AI语音SDK

李明是一位年轻的软件开发者,热衷于人工智能领域的研究。在一次偶然的机会,他接触到了AI语音SDK,这让他对语音识别和语音合成产生了浓厚的兴趣。在深入了解AI语音SDK后,李明发现它具有强大的语音识别、语音合成、语音唤醒等功能,可以应用于各种场景。

二、寻找智能推荐功能的应用场景

在了解了AI语音SDK的功能后,李明开始思考如何将其应用于实际场景。经过一番调研,他发现智能推荐功能在智能家居领域具有很大的应用前景。智能家居设备可以通过语音指令与用户进行交互,实现家电的远程控制、场景切换等功能。而智能推荐功能则可以帮助用户更好地了解和使用智能家居设备。

三、技术选型与方案设计

在确定了应用场景后,李明开始着手进行技术选型与方案设计。他选择了某知名AI语音SDK作为开发平台,该SDK具有以下特点:

  1. 支持多种语音识别引擎,识别准确率高;
  2. 支持多语言、多方言识别;
  3. 支持语音合成、语音唤醒等功能;
  4. 提供丰富的API接口,方便开发者进行二次开发。

基于以上特点,李明设计了以下方案:

  1. 用户通过语音指令与智能家居设备进行交互,如“打开空调”、“播放音乐”等;
  2. AI语音SDK将用户的语音指令转换为文本,并进行分析;
  3. 根据用户的历史使用数据、设备状态等信息,AI语音SDK为用户推荐合适的操作;
  4. 用户确认推荐操作后,智能家居设备执行相应操作。

四、实现智能推荐功能

在技术选型与方案设计完成后,李明开始着手实现智能推荐功能。以下是实现过程中的关键步骤:

  1. 集成AI语音SDK:将AI语音SDK集成到智能家居设备中,实现语音识别、语音合成等功能;
  2. 数据收集与处理:收集用户使用智能家居设备的历史数据,如设备使用频率、用户偏好等,并进行处理;
  3. 模型训练:利用收集到的数据,训练智能推荐模型,使其能够根据用户需求推荐合适的操作;
  4. 推荐结果展示:将推荐结果以语音或文本形式展示给用户,供用户确认。

五、测试与优化

在实现智能推荐功能后,李明对系统进行了全面测试。测试过程中,他发现以下问题:

  1. 语音识别准确率有待提高;
  2. 智能推荐模型在部分场景下表现不佳;
  3. 用户交互体验有待优化。

针对以上问题,李明进行了以下优化:

  1. 优化语音识别算法,提高识别准确率;
  2. 优化智能推荐模型,使其在更多场景下表现良好;
  3. 优化用户交互界面,提升用户体验。

六、总结

通过使用AI语音SDK实现语音指令的智能推荐功能,李明成功地将人工智能技术应用于智能家居领域。在这个过程中,他不仅积累了丰富的实践经验,还结识了一群志同道合的朋友。相信在不久的将来,人工智能技术将在更多领域发挥重要作用,为我们的生活带来更多便利。

猜你喜欢:AI客服